1. Why Pilates Studio Flooring Matters
A reformer is only as stable as the surface it rests on. When a client pushes through lunges or works through spring resistance, every bit of movement translates from the carriage through the frame and into the floor. If that floor is too soft, too hard, or uneven, the reformer shifts, joints creak, and the session loses its precision. Proper pilates studio flooring eliminates these issues by providing a stable, level foundation for your equipment.
Beyond stability, flooring plays a starring role in acoustics. Thin, hard surfaces amplify the clatter of springs and straps, creating a noisy environment that distracts both the client and the instructor. In a boutique studio where the experience is the product, sound quality matters just as much as the equipment itself and the quality of instruction provided during each session throughout the day.
There is also the hygiene angle. Pilates studios see bare feet, mats, sweat, and regular cleaning rotations. A flooring material that absorbs moisture or traps dust becomes a breeding ground for bacteria and odours. Selecting the wrong surface can lead to higher cleaning costs, faster wear, and even liability issues over time as the studio floor degrades and requires premature replacement or costly repairs to maintain safety standards.

2. Rubber Flooring — The Commercial Standard
Rubber flooring is the default choice for commercial fitness environments for good reason. It offers high density without being rock-hard, providing enough give to absorb impact while keeping reformers planted firmly in place. High-quality rubber tiles or rolled sheets in the 6 mm to 10 mm thickness range deliver an ideal balance of shock absorption and stability for reformer work in busy studio environments with heavy daily use.
One of the biggest advantages of rubber is its noise-dampening capability. A 6 mm rubber mat under a reformer can reduce transmitted spring noise by as much as 40 percent compared with bare wood or concrete, making your studio quieter and more professional. Rubber is also naturally slip-resistant, even when wet, which matters for transition zones where clients step off the reformer onto the floor during class transitions.
Cleaning is straightforward — a quick mop with a mild disinfectant keeps rubber surfaces fresh and odour-resistant. The main trade-off is weight and cost. Commercial-grade rubber flooring runs higher per square metre than vinyl or carpet, and once installed, it is not easy to replace. However, a properly installed rubber floor can last a decade or more in a busy studio, making the upfront investment worthwhile for long-term studio operations.

3. Cork Flooring — Natural Cushioning with Acoustic Benefits
Cork flooring is gaining popularity in Pilates studios for its unique combination of cushioning, acoustic absorption, and environmental sustainability. Cork is naturally antimicrobial, which helps prevent mould and bacterial growth in moist studio environments where sweat and cleaning solutions are present daily. The cellular structure of cork provides natural insulation against both sound and temperature, keeping the studio quieter and more comfortable throughout the day.
Cork is softer underfoot than rubber, which can be more comfortable for clients walking barefoot between equipment stations. However, this softness means cork may compress over time under the weight of heavy commercial reformers, particularly in high-traffic areas where equipment is moved or repositioned frequently. Thicker cork planks (8 mm to 12 mm) with high-density core construction are recommended for studio applications to minimize compression and extend the floor’s service life.
One limitation of cork is its susceptibility to moisture damage. While sealed cork flooring is water-resistant, standing water or prolonged exposure to moisture can cause the material to swell or warp. Studios using cork flooring should ensure proper ventilation and address spills promptly to maintain the integrity of the surface over years of continuous operation in a commercial fitness setting with frequent cleaning requirements.
4. Vinyl and Hybrid Flooring Options
Luxury vinyl plank (LVP) and luxury vinyl tile (LVT) are increasingly popular choices for Pilates studios that want the look of wood or stone without the cost and maintenance of natural materials. Modern vinyl flooring is available in thicknesses from 4 mm to 8 mm, with wear layers that resist scuffing from reformer rails and cleaning chemicals used in daily studio sanitation protocols and maintenance routines.
Vinyl offers several advantages for pilates studio flooring. It is completely waterproof, which eliminates the moisture concerns associated with cork and hardwood. It is also one of the easiest flooring materials to clean — a damp mop with a neutral cleaner is sufficient for daily maintenance. The surface is firm enough to provide stable support for reformers while offering some underfoot comfort for barefoot clients moving between equipment stations.
The main drawback of vinyl is limited acoustic performance. Without an acoustic underlayment, vinyl floors can amplify spring and strap noise compared to rubber or cork. Studio owners considering vinyl should plan for a quality acoustic underlayment (minimum 3 mm) to reduce noise transmission and improve the overall sound environment in the studio during classes and private training sessions held throughout the day.

6. How Flooring Affects Reformer Stability
Reformer stability is directly linked to the density and flatness of your pilates studio flooring. Soft flooring materials like thick carpet allow the reformer frame to sink unevenly, causing the carriage to move at an angle rather than parallel to the rails. This misalignment increases wear on bearings and rails, leading to premature equipment failure and inconsistent resistance throughout the range of motion during client exercise sessions.
Hard, level surfaces provide the best foundation for reformer equipment. Rubber and vinyl installed over a level concrete subfloor create an ideal surface because the combination of density and flatness ensures the reformer frame sits perfectly level. Even minor floor irregularities can cause reformers to rock during use, which clients perceive as poor equipment quality even when the reformer itself is in perfect condition and meeting all manufacturer specifications.
For studios installing reformers on upper floors, consider the combined weight of equipment and clients. A room with 10 reformers and 10 clients adds approximately 3,000 kg (6,600 lbs) of live load. Ensure your flooring choice and subfloor structure can support this weight without deflection, which would compromise both equipment stability and client safety during dynamic reformer exercises performed throughout each class session.
7. Installation Considerations for Studio Owners
Professional installation is strongly recommended for commercial Pilates studio flooring. Unlike residential flooring, studio flooring must maintain perfectly level surfaces across the entire room because reformers cannot be adjusted to compensate for uneven floors. A difference of even 3 mm across a reformer’s footprint can cause noticeable rocking during use, creating a poor client experience and potential safety concerns that need to be addressed.
Acoustic underlayment is an important consideration regardless of your primary flooring material. A quality underlayment reduces impact noise from foot traffic and equipment movement, which matters particularly in multi-story buildings where downstairs tenants or other businesses share the same structure. The Pilates Method Alliance recommends consulting with an acoustic specialist when designing studio spaces in commercial buildings with shared occupancy to ensure appropriate noise isolation measures are implemented.
Consider the transition zones between different flooring materials in your studio. Areas where clients walk from reception to the studio floor, or from mat areas to reformer zones, should use smooth transitions to prevent tripping hazards. Threshold strips and edge trim should be flush with both flooring surfaces to maintain a professional appearance and comply with accessibility requirements for commercial fitness facilities operating in your region.

¿Cuál es el mejor suelo para un estudio de Pilates con máquinas Reformer?
El suelo de caucho (de 6 a 10 mm de grosor) es el más recomendado para los estudios de pilates comerciales. Ofrece una excelente estabilidad, insonorización y durabilidad. El corcho es una buena alternativa para los estudios boutique que dan prioridad a los materiales naturales.
¿Puedo instalar reformers sobre moqueta?
No se recomienda el uso de moqueta en los estudios comerciales de Pilates. Su superficie blanda hace que las máquinas «reformer» se desplacen y se balanceen durante su uso, acelera el desgaste de los rodamientos y retiene el polvo y la humedad. La moqueta puede ser aceptable para uso doméstico con equipos más ligeros, pero debe evitarse en entornos de estudios profesionales.
¿Qué grosor debe tener el suelo de mi estudio de Pilates?
Para uso comercial, los suelos de caucho deben tener un grosor de entre 6 y 10 mm. Los de corcho, de entre 8 y 12 mm. Los de vinilo, de entre 4 y 8 mm, con una capa base acústica de 3 mm. Los materiales más gruesos ofrecen una mejor reducción del ruido, pero pueden aumentar la complejidad de la instalación y los costes del material por metro cuadrado.
¿Influye el tipo de suelo en la garantía del reformer?
La mayoría de los fabricantes de reformers exigen que el equipo se instale sobre una superficie nivelada y estable. Un suelo que permita que el reformer se balancee o se desplace puede anular la garantía. Comprueba siempre los requisitos de instalación del fabricante de tu reformer antes de elegir los materiales para el suelo.
¿Cuánto cuesta el suelo de un estudio de Pilates?
Costs vary by material: rubber $30-60 per square meter, cork $25-50, luxury vinyl $20-45, commercial carpet $15-35, hardwood $40-80. Installation costs add $10-25 per square meter depending on the complexity of the installation and subfloor preparation required.
Can I use gym mats under individual reformers?
Individual gym mats under reformers are a cost-effective solution but do not provide the same level of stability as full-room flooring. Mats can shift during use and create tripping hazards. For permanent studio setups, full-room flooring is recommended for safety and professional appearance.
How do I clean Pilates studio flooring?
Rubber and vinyl flooring can be cleaned with a damp mop and mild disinfectant daily. Cork requires special pH-neutral cleaners and should not be wet-mopped. Avoid abrasive cleaners or scrub brushes that can damage the surface finish and void the flooring warranty over time.
